adopted parents: William Brockman and Elizabeth Mason 1. He was a Baptist minister. 2. Held the ranks of Ensign and 1st Lt. in the 1st Co. 88 Rgt. in the Revolution. 3. Information from Paul R. Brockman, GenForum 21 Dec 1998: "Rev. Ambrose Brockman, 1764 to 1823, was Thomas's younger brother. Thomas also named a son Ambrose, and Rev. Ambrose Brockman named a son Ambrose, Jr. The Ambroses were named for Rev. Ambrose Mason, an early Baptist preacher in central Virginia who was a brother of Thomas's mother, Elizabeth Mason Brockman." 4. His will was dated 22 Sep 1823; he died at the age of 59y 3m and 6d. 5. His second marriage took place at Burlington, Boone co., KY. SOURCES INCLUDE: The Brockman Scrapbook, pages 24-25, 27-29, 41, 183-185 (will), 412-414 War of 1812 pension claim). Orange County Virginia Families III:109. Orange County Virginia Families IV:87.
